There are three options when a soccer ball is coming directly at your face. You can use your head to try to play the ball to a teammate, you can duck or bob out of the way, or you can let it hit your face.

If you are training for futsal, you should use a futsal ball. It moves, feels, and reacts differently than a soccer ball. However, if you only have a soccer ball available, it would still be good to train with that one until you can get a futsal ball of your own.

Soccer sneakers should be tight for better ball control and proper shooting. Soccer shoes cannot be lose because it won't allowed you to dribble and pass the ball well. Wear thick soccer socks and the shoes will eventually mold to your fit.
